Linux işletim sisteminde her dosya, dosyayı kimin okuyabileceğini, yazabileceğini veya çalıştırabileceğini tanımlayan özniteliklere sahiptir. Bu niteliklere dosya izinleri denir.
Linux'ta erişim hakları, dosya ve dizinlere erişimi yalnızca bunlara erişmesi gereken kullanıcılarla kısıtlamak için önemli bir güvenlik mekanizmasıdır. Bu, hassas bilgilerin korunmasına ve sisteme ve dosyalarına yetkisiz erişimin önlenmesine yardımcı olur.
Linux'ta, diğer çok kullanıcılı sistemlerde olduğu gibi, farklı kullanıcılar dosya ve dizinlere farklı erişim haklarına sahiptir. Bu, her kullanıcının yalnızca kendisinin erişebildiği kendi dosya ve dizinlerine sahip olabileceği ve diğer kullanıcılara ait dosya ve dizinlere erişiminin kısıtlanabileceği anlamına gelir.
İzinler, kullanıcıların dosya ve dizinlerle yapabileceklerini kısıtlayabilir, örneğin kullanıcının tam erişiminin olmadığı dosyaların silinmesini veya değiştirilmesini yasaklayabilir. Bu, sistem performansı için öngörülemeyen sonuçlar doğurabilecek önemli sistem dosyalarının yanlışlıkla silinmesini veya değiştirilmesini önlemeye yardımcı olur.
Linux'ta erişim hakları, sistemi ve dosyaları yetkisiz erişimden korumaya yardımcı olan ve dosya ve dizinlerle çalışırken kazara kullanıcı hatalarını önleyen önemli bir güvenlik mekanizmasıdır.
Linux'ta erişim hakları üç türe ayrılır:
(Sahip
)Grup
Diğerleri
Linux'taki her dosya, kimin dosyayla hangi işlemleri yapabileceğini belirleyen bir izinler kümesine sahiptir. Örneğin, bir dosyanın sahibi dosya üzerinde okuma, yazma ve yürütme izinlerine sahip olabilir, bir grup dosya üzerinde salt okuma ve yürütme izinlerine sahip olabilir ve diğer kullanıcılar dosya üzerinde salt okuma izinlerine sahip olabilir.
Linux'ta dosya izinleri chmod
komutu kullanılarak değiştirilebilir. Bu komutla, her kullanıcı türü (sahip, grup ve diğer kullanıcılar) için belirli erişim hakları ayarlayabilirsiniz.